I am trying to put text on a new revision part I made. I need to put an string of text on all of our revision parts.
I haven't been able to find any journals for this so I just recorded it. I do not know how to take care of line 82. This buttons should be universal for my parts but I do not know how to have it extract faces correctly. Any ideas?

The extractFace1 variable isn't used anywhere else except in line 82; try commenting out that line and test to see what happens.
